Cucurbitacins from Cayaponia racemosa: isolation and total assignment of 1H and 13C NMR spectra

✍ Scribed by Davina C. Chaves; João Carlos C. Assunção; Raimundo Braz-Filho; Telma L. G. Lemos; Francisco J. Q. Monte

✦ Synopsis


Abstract

Two new cucurbitane‐type triterpenoids, 2β,3β,16α,20(R),25‐pentahydroxy‐9‐methyl‐19‐norlanost‐5‐en‐7,22‐dione and 2β,3β,16α,20(R),25‐pentahydroxy‐9‐methyl‐19‐norlanost‐5‐en‐7,11,22‐trione, were isolated from fruits of Cayaponia racemosa. The total ^1^H and ^13^C chemical shift assignment of these two closely related compounds is described, making use of one‐ and two‐dimensional NMR techniques.
